Background
In the traditional double-cavity extrusion die for the automobile sealing element, a supporting device of the traditional double-cavity extrusion die for the automobile sealing element structurally comprises a T-shaped process rib 1 forming part (shown in figures 1 and 2) on two sides of an extrusion port 5 for forming a sealing element product and a supporting block 4 (shown in figure 3), wherein the T-shaped process rib 1 forming part is arranged on a die forming plate part of the extrusion port 3 for forming the sealing element product, after a die extrusion part is initially formed, the T-shaped process ribs 1 on two sides are adhered to corresponding positions of the product, and a T-shaped supporting tool adjusts the opening of the product.
Wherein, the supporting shoe 4 includes ejector pin 41, connecting rod 42, cardboard 44, and ejector pin 41 passes through connecting rod 42 and connects cardboard 44, and the bottom of cardboard 44 is equipped with draw-in groove 43 for the card is on the staple 2, and in T shape straight flute 3 was located to cardboard 44, ejector pin 41 located the centre of the extrusion mouth 5 of two shaping sealing member products position under one's own right.
The original supporting block 4 is designed, the position can be adjusted in the Y direction to control the opening, the T-shaped technological rib 1 needs to be adjusted by an auxiliary regulating wheel, multiple adjustments are needed for one product to meet the requirement, the scrapping cost of the machine adjusting is higher, the double cavities are separated, and the machine receiving and online adjustment are not easy to achieve.

Detailed Description
In order to make the present invention more comprehensible, preferred embodiments are described in detail below with reference to the accompanying drawings.
The utility model relates to an online quick adjustment's tapering profile modeling strutting arrangement is extruded to sealing member two-chamber of car, as shown in fig. 4, fig. 5, it supports positioning adjustment device 6 including the extrusion outlet mould play plate 7 of locating between 3 bottom surfaces of T shape straight flute and the location nail 2 and the tapering that can supply location nail 2 to pass, extrusion outlet mould play plate 7 supports positioning adjustment device 6 fixed connection with the tapering, be provided with the extrusion outlet 5 of shaping sealing member product on extrusion outlet mould play plate 7, the tapering supports positioning adjustment device 6 and is close to the 5 position settings of extrusion outlet of shaping sealing member product.
The upper end of the taper supporting and positioning adjusting device 6 is a profiling structure, and the profiling structure is matched with a product structure from an extrusion port 5 for forming a sealing element product. The upper end of the taper supporting and positioning adjusting device 6 is flush with the upper end of the extrusion port die-forming plate 7. The extrusion die outlet plate 7 has an inverted U-shaped structure, and the opening of the inverted U-shaped structure is a limiting groove 71 which is opened downwards. The lower end of the taper supporting and positioning adjusting device 6 is provided with a lower groove 64 for the positioning nail 2 to pass through, the profiling structure comprises an upper groove 63, the top of the upper groove 63 is provided with a platform 61, and a taper transition structure 62 is arranged between the upper groove 63 and the platform 61. The shape of the tapered transition structure 62 matches the contact portion of the product structure exiting the extrusion orifice 5 of the profiled seal product.
The taper supporting and positioning adjusting device 6 is made of polytetrafluoroethylene.
As shown in FIG. 6, the supporting device of the present invention is installed on the die-out plate of the extrusion opening 5 of the formed sealing member product, and the opening of the one-die dual-cavity sealing strip and the dual-cavity adhesion function can be adjusted on line. Through the utility model discloses a strutting arrangement carries out the primary design back to a product, can directly support the laminating degree that the frock highly comes spacing two-chamber product through the adjustment tapering.
